Rhode Island Weather for March 7, 2026
Morning:
The day starts cloudy with patchy fog possible early on, and a low chance of lingering drizzle before mid-morning. Temperatures begin in the low to mid 40s°F, feeling cool and damp with light winds, but the fog gradually lifts by late morning.
Afternoon:
Conditions become mostly cloudy to partly sunny as patchy fog dissipates, with highs reaching around 48°F. No significant precipitation is expected, winds remain light (around 5-10 mph), and it feels noticeably milder than recent days, making it decent for outdoor activities with layers.
Evening:
Skies stay mostly cloudy transitioning to overcast, with temperatures dropping into the low to mid 40s°F by nightfall. Dry overall, but cooler and potentially breezy at times, leading into a cloudy night with lows around 43°F.
